porkChop3116d ago

For the most part I would agree. But when it comes to id's games, 60fps is really important. One of the biggest draws of any id game is how it feels to play, and 60fps is a big part of that. I get why they cut it to 30fps, but I wish there was at least a patch to add a 60fps option.

PhantomTommy3116d ago

If you watch any developer interviews about new DOOM, they always bring up just how important 60fps is to the experience. Carmack's Doom 4 was targeting 30fps on console, but Id were adamant that the reboot HAD to run at 60fps. That's why it's a shame to see the framerate halved on Switch, not because 30fps games are bad or unplayable, but because it's clearly not how the developers wanted people to experience the game.

Spiders Studio, Developers of GreedFall: The Dying World, Announce Liquidation of the Company

Spiders: "We're going to cut straight to the chase so you're not left wondering: After a long period without clear answers, we have received confirmation that Spiders is being liquidated.

What does it mean? This means the company as a whole no longer exists. We'll cease our functions immediately. The planned DLC will release via Nacon, and then-- well, that's it.

We're sorry that it's come to this and would like to thank each and every one of you for your support over the years.

If you have any questions or run into issues with your games, please contact Nacon directly as we'll no longer be able to reply."
